For fund managers, family offices and developers allocating into climate
Technical diligence tells you whether it works. It does not tell you whether a buyer is compelled to act, whether this team can execute what the deck describes, or whether capital, regulation and buyer urgency arrive at the same time. Climate Sprints assesses all three before you commit and works with your portfolio company after you do.
The market
Where capital went in the first half of 2026, and what it left behind.
on the fewest deals ever recorded.
Climate tech held near $41.3 billion globally in the first half of 2026 while deal count fell to a record low. Average round size rose from $18 million to $27 million.2 Series C took 40 percent of venture funding, up from 16 percent a year earlier. Low-carbon data centers alone absorbed 34 percent of the sector, up from 3 percent.3
Capital did not leave climate. It concentrated into assets that already resemble infrastructure, and it left the middle — the distance between a technology that works and a first commercial deployment — thinly funded and badly assessed.
